Deploy Guide — Step 6: Tile Cache Layer (Mapwright)

Drain the old Hollis cache nodes before cutover. Verify the new tile-render cache answers on the internal port, then run the warm script against the top 200 regions — takes about ten minutes. Do not flip traffic until hit rate exceeds 80% on the Mapwright panel. Confirm eviction policy reads "lru-region" in the status output. The cache's write path authenticates to the render farm, so append the credential line to the env file now.

sealed setting: RELAY_SECRET5=82864

**Ticket: Staging env misconfigured for locker access flow**

The Tumblebox laundry-locker service in staging is rejecting unlock requests because the env file still points at the retired gateway and omits the signing credential entirely. Users scanning a locker code get a generic failure. Reviewer: please confirm the diff updates LOCKER_GATEWAY_URL to the new staging host and drops the dead TUMBLEBOX_LEGACY_KEY entry. Once those edits are in, the file's final line should set the gateway signing secret:

sealed setting: ARCHIVE_KEY3=8d0

**Release checklist — item 7: trace propagation**

Reviewer, please confirm the `x-hopline-trace` header survives the full hop from `gateway-api` through `cart-svc` to `ledger-svc`. Last release, Dovel's refactor dropped it at the gRPC boundary and we flew blind for two days. The smoke test in `traces/e2e_hop.py` should show one contiguous span tree, no orphans. Sign off only after eyeballing the staging trace viewer. The reference trace for this release candidate is recorded below.

session token of tajog-fahaf = htk21_4ae55819f45410afcb307

Key item: hiring freeze in the Fabrication Division remains in force. Instituted last quarter after the Dornway contract slipped. All open requisitions paused except two safety-critical roles. Temp cover approved through quarter-end only. Payroll forecasts already reflect the freeze; do not reverse without CFO sign-off. Division head (Marta Quense) has been briefed and is compliant, though pressing for exceptions. Review scheduled at next planning cycle. Context on where this fits strategically is in the note below.

board note of bawep-tajef: Queniusek Systems plans to raise the Quenvan list price by 53.1 percent in March. The pricing group signed off on a budget of $176.4 million for Project Drueth. The renewal with Casionix Partners closes at $142.5 million a year, 8.3 percent below the last contract. Project Fraax slips by six weeks because of the tooling delay.